Azul Helps Cinnober Add Zing to its Java Solution
By including Zing, Cinnober improves response time predictability in its trading, clearing and risk management solutions. It will also result in reduced Java virtual machine (JVM) tuning requirements, which enables faster deliveries of new capabilities. The move complements Cinnober's work with orchestrated memory management, achieving pause-free execution in servers that are critical for low response times.
"Our TradeExpress Ultra technology already enables trading and clearing systems with consistent response times and the lowest latency available, at single-digit microseconds," says Veronica Augustsson, CEO of Cinnober. "Now Azul's supplementary real-time JVM can provide every one of our offerings with consistent response time. Zing is an outstanding JVM with regard to predictability in the demanding domain of financial IT."
With Zing, Cinnober's customers can eliminate latency outliers and deliver scalability as order rates, in-memory data set sizes or user loads grow. Developers can also utilize all available Java libraries and functions.
Zing can be implemented with TRADExpress solutions simply by replacing a system's current JVM, without recompiling or re-architecting. This allows the system to meet service level agreements with regard to predictability and eliminating latency outliers.
